Fabrizio Gatta, from Rai face to priest: “Success is not enough for you anymore”

From Rai face to priest. Fabrizio Gatta, historical conductor of Green line e One morning, he chose, one day, to renounce everything he could say he knew to follow, only, his own spiritual vocation. “The love that changes your life forever is the love for God. I left everything for Him. And Our Lord has really changed my life”, he told the XIX century the former presenter, who in 2013 decided to embrace the faith. No more television, no more women.

Nothing. “My mom used to take the drops to sleep,” admitted Gatta, recounting how her spiritual will did not get an immediate positive response.

“The driver with the money, the powerful cars, used to the good life, who leaves everything”, he tried to explain, underlining how, however, a time has come when “What you do is not enough for you anymore. Success, money, share, applause are no longer enough for you. So you try to do good. To commit yourself. To make a long distance adoption. Try to understand the Mystery. And you get involved “, continued Gatta, who, He graduated in Theology and was ordained a deacon in Sanremo, where he will officially become a priest on 7 December.

Gatta, who as a child dreamed of becoming Pippo Baudo, explained that he had had “moments of distance” with faith. Especially, “During adolescence”. But, “Crises are needed to be overcome.” And the former Rai face, his, managed to win it.
